Australia Physical Vapor Deposition On Plastics Market Overview

This niche within the PVD market focuses on applying vapor deposition coatings specifically on plastic substrates. It serves industries such as packaging, automotive interiors, and consumer electronics, where lightweight and decorative yet durable plastic components are required. Innovations in adhesion and coating technologies have expanded applications, making this market segment increasingly vital in sectors prioritizing both aesthetics and functionality.

Challenges of the market

Applying PVD coatings on plastics brings specific technical difficulties, such as achieving consistent coating thickness without damaging heat-sensitive plastic substrates. Limited research and development tailored to plastic materials restrict the growth potential. The market also contends with environmental regulations governing emissions during the coating process, increasing operational complexity and cost.
